Floating Terms(What it is)???

So,being into proper web development for last one year,I come across a number of floating terms(headless CMS,static generator,bundler and so on) that make it more intimidating for newbies to grab the concepts. I learned most of the terms the hard way.
Won't it be helping anyone if we make a common GitHub repo where anyone can explain these terms in a layman way through pull requests and then whosoever is writing a technical post,can include those jargons as a link to the GitHub repo. If the reader need to know more,they can visit the site,else an experienced reader can go and finish reading the article.
Thoughts please(or clarity if we are already having some service like this).

